I TOLD GOD I WANTED THIS BUT HE DISAPPOINTED ME.

There was a time I was praying for my Dad to get a job. I prayed, searched online for new openings, asked my friends to send me job offers so I could send to him. Finally, he got a call to come for an interview
I was so happy. I prayed, danced and thanked God. I remember telling my dad he was going to kill it and God was going to come through for him. My dad went for the interview and later on, he wasn& #39;t given the job. I was hurt, angry, mad at God. I remember telling God I hated him.
I refused to understand God. I was too angry. I was angry that he deceived me(I thought he did). He told me my dad was going to get a job but why this? Why was he rejected? I didn& #39;t understand it. I called God a liar. I hated God. I chose to give up.
I remember calling one of my friends and crying to her about it. Then she said "God is not a liar". God said your dad was going to get a job but did he say it was going to be this job? She said I know you wanted this for him but what God has is far more greater than this.
Isaiah 55:11
[11]So shall My word be that goes forth out of My mouth: it shall not return to Me void [without producing any effect, useless], but it shall accomplish that which I please and purpose, and it shall prosper in the thing for which I sent it.
Then I remembered the bible passage above. God has said it and he& #39;ll do it and guess what? He did it!!! Far beyond my expectations. God is not man that he should lie. Yes you wanted that job but did you ask God if that was the job he already prepared for you.
Isaiah 55:8-9
[8]For My thoughts are not your thoughts, neither are your ways My ways, says the Lord.
[9]For as the heavens are higher than the earth, so are My ways higher than your ways and My thoughts than your thoughts.
The ways of God are mysterious. Cast all your cares and burdens upon him. He has heard you and he will do it. Has he said a thing and has refused to bring it to pass? The job you& #39;re crying over is not what God has prepared for you.
You need to understand that whatever God says is yours is yours!!! When the appointed time comes, you enter into it. Don& #39;t cry over that cgpa, job, finances. God says I have heard you, just listen to me. Be patient. Our God is a God of marvels!!!
When God prepares a place for you, no man can take over that place because has handed it over to you. The mercy of God is bringing you into places you can& #39;t even imagine just trust God. He would never disappoint you.
Philippians 4:6
[6]Do not fret or have any anxiety about anything, but in every circumstance and in everything, by prayer and petition (definite requests), with thanksgiving, continue to make your wants known to God.
